CALL FOR PRESENTATIONS (Proposals are due October 31, 2006)
The organizing theme for this year's Multiple Perspectives conference
"Rights, Responsibilities & Social Change" seems appropriate to a year
that has seen the passage of the United Nation's Convention on the
Rights of Persons with Disabilities and looks forward to the public
debate an impending presidential election encourages. Continuing the
tradition of the past six years, the Seventh Annual Multiple
Perspectives conference will bring together a diverse audience to
explore disability as both an individual experience and social reality
that cuts across typical divisions of education & employment;
scholarship & service; business & government; race, gender & ethnicity.
The theme is meant to encourage presenters and participants to consider
topics, methods and programs from a fresh perspective.
